Dear Sven, 2.3 is the value that will be used as the cluster-forming threshold for your f-stat(s), if you don't want cluster-corrected results then you can use the --T2 option or even just -x for voxelwise results. The F-test is a statistic type, --T2, -F, -x etc are just various methods for dealing with multiple-comparisons.
